>>> It looks correct to me for the krb5 interface.  It looks like some of the
>>> internal libraries that Heimdal uses (maybe libroken and libasn1,
>>> although I'm not sure) aren't using symbol versioning, but since that
>>> isn't the API that's shared with MIT Kerberos, that shouldn't matter in
>>> practice.  I doubt this is a regression from the previous state; they
>>> were probably never using symbol versioning.
